Remember that when you start streaming video through a Chromecast, it's pulling the feed directly from the web, not your laptop or your phone. If you're worried that doing something else will kill your video feed, don't be: all you have to do is hit Alt+Tab on your keyboard to switch to a different app, and your video will stay casting. You may want to use your computer to cast a video to your TV, but while watching you may also want to use your computer to do something else. It'll then ask whether they want to play the video now or add it to a playlist – by choosing to add to the playlist, everyone can contribute. In the YouTube app, have people tap the cast icon on their chosen video. YouTube, for instance, will let you create and play a shared playlist on Chromecast.Īll you have to do is make sure everyone is connected to the same Wi-Fi network as the Chromecast and has the YouTube app downloaded. The Chromecast is all about shifting stuff from your phone, tablet or computer to your TV, but this doesn't mean that you can't have other people participate. Make sure Do Not Disturb is not turned on.Make sure the volume is turned up all the way. You can adjust the volume of your ringer by pressing the volume buttons on the side of your phone. To turn off Silent mode, flip the switch down. If it is flipped up, your iPhone is in Silent mode. You can check this by looking for the orange switch on the left side of your phone. While many items can be recycled for free, we must charge recycling fees for TVs, some computer monitors, and items containing Freon, such as Refrigerators and AC Units, as well as Alkaline Batteries, Ink/Toner Cartridges, and Magnetic and Optical media. The basic rule at MRC is that we accept almost anything that plugs into a wall, or takes batteries (even if they are broken) We can help you unload your vehicle (especially if you have something heavy), and can provide certificates of proper recycling upon request. You can bring by nearly anything that uses a power cord or battery to drop off for recycling, including appliances, and most electronics can be recycled for free! Refer to our Jefferson City drop-off hours above. Jefferson City, MO, can take many types of old electronics and get them out of your house the right way. Midwest Recycling Center (MRC) located at 1327 MO-179 Jefferson City is truly fortunate to have a place to be able to take old electronic items and have them environmentally recycled. There’s really no way that reporting them helps and since they are also coming from different email addresses even if you block that address, you’re really not helping yourself. The best thing you could do is delete these type of emails. ![]() It takes you to Apple’s on service on the device. It doesn’t ask you directly for credit card information. Apple will not provide an email such as this to tell you your account storage is full, if your account storage is full, you will see a pop-up message on your Apple device that when you click lead you to your iCloud information on the particular device. It may be passwords to your account, or it may be credit card or banking information don’t fall for this. The whole idea is to scare you into thinking there’s a problem and get you to click a link and go down some path that’s going to provide them something. They don’t get into your computer, they don’t hack you, they get you to hack yourself. Social engineering is an attempt to get you to cause your self problems or provide private information like credit card data to the scammer. This is just another example of social engineering. There are many emails out there being sent to people that tell you your iCloud storage is full and that they’re going to delete all of your files and photo, they attempt to get you to click a link provide them a credit card, and update your Apple iCloud storage. Here’s one that’s affecting lots of people in the Apple ecosystem. Common items can only hold a couple of engravings, but rare or legendary loot can hold many more. Odyssey has a huge system of engravings that add buffs and bonuses to gear: +10% warrior damage, +5% damage to Spartans, and so on. This automatically upgraded the entire Snake set to level 27, letting me save my precious materials for something else. For example, I first collected four out of five pieces at the Snake set between levels 15 to 25, but the final piece I collected was at level 27. One thing to keep in mind is that when collecting sets of Legendary Armor the whole set will automatically upgrade to the level of the last piece you collected. Have a favorite sword you've been using since level 10, but it just can't cut it (har har) now that you're at level 15? Pay a blacksmith and boom, your favorite sword is now a level 15 sword. Odyssey avoids that shame by offering an unlimited (though expensive in in-game resources) ability to upgrade any piece of gear to the current player level. I keenly remember equipping some polka-dotted jester's monstrosity in the Witcher 3 just because it had the best armor stats I could afford at the time. In fact, one of the really liberating things about gear in Odyssey is that it's almost absurdly customizable and upgradable. Heavy maces are huge and slow, for example, but they kill Athenians every bit as dead as a dagger. Thankfully, I found that I was pretty much free to pick whatever I thought looked cool, since all of the weapons seem to be equally effective. There are a bunch of different weapon types-including swords, axes, staffs, spears, and daggers-and they all handle a bit differently and have different special attacks. Weapons and armor play a huge role in character growth in Odyssey. Super Mario Rpg: Legend of the Seven Stars ![]() Law enforcement often described the Demeo crew as the deadliest and most feared Mafia crew of the 5 Families in New York. The FBI claimed the DeMeo crew was responsible for as many as 200-300 murders from the mid-1970s to the early 1980s. I remember a Sopranos’ episode where they cut up Richie Aprile’s body in Satriale’s Pork Store using the utensils normally used for the pork. Roy DeMeo had once worked as a butcher in his early life, and some mob historians claim the Gemini Lounge was more like the killing floor in a slaughterhouse except they killed and butchered humans instead of pigs. Like the Jimmy Burke crew meeting at the nearby Bamboo Lounge, the DeMeo crew came in almost every day and drank, planned scores, critiqued past scores, gossiped as any mafia crew might do at their social club. The building is still there, and in an ironic twist, it is now the Purpose Life Church. He installed his cousin, crew member Joseph “Dracula” Guglielmo, into the adjoining apartment as a security procedure to prevent the NYPD cops and/or FBI from planting listening devices. DeMeo was a gun nut and he stored an impressive arsenal of machineguns, automatic rifles, and silencers in a storeroom at the lounge. During this time he recruited another psychopathic killer named Henry Borelli. DeMeo owned a Brooklyn tavern at 4021 Flatlands Ave. He became a proficient killer who will live on in mob lore for the deeds of “DeMeo crew.” Joey Testa and Anthony Senter, who became known as the “Gemini Twins,” were the most feared crew members. A New Murder Inc.Īfter a life devoted to crime in his teens and early 20s, Nino Gaggi will mentor Roy Demeo as an associate of the Gambino crime family. Joseph “Dracula” Guglielmo, Anthony Senter, and brothers Joseph Testa and Patrick Testa became the core members of Demeo’s crew. In the early 1970s, Chris introduced some of his friends to Roy. ![]() With Roy as his partner, Chris became an illegal drug wholesaler with street dealers working for him. Roy had connections and money that allowed Rosenberg to deal with narcotics in larger amounts. DeMeo finds Rosenberg hanging out at a popular Canarsie gas station where he was basically a street dealer. ![]() One of his first recruits is a high school friend named Chris Rosenberg. He recruited other neighborhood guys to steal cars and sell drugs. Roy DeMeo will find other criminal opportunities as an associate to Gaggi’s crew. Nino Gaggi uses his Gambino connections to increase young Roy’s loanshark business by investing his cash into the young loan shark and sent him men who needed larger loans than DeMeo’s high school friends. ![]() Growing up in this atmosphere young Roy DeMeo, not unlike Henry Hill, notices that the men who have the money as represented by cash, cars, jewelry, and neighbor respect are all “connected guys” like Nino Gaggi. It would be during this time he is noticed by a Gambino crime family soldier named Nino Gaggi who takes him under his wing. As a teenager, he starts loansharking while enrolled in James Madison High School. Roy Albert DeMeo was born into the Mafia neighborhood of Bath Beach Brooklyn.
